The HR Systems Analyst is responsible for maintaining the integrity, reliability, and functionality of PACE Southeast Michigan's HRIS (Human Resources Information System). This position supports effective data management, reporting, and process enhancements while making sure that HRIS solutions satisfy the changing demands, specifications, and strategic goals of the HR division. To maximize HRIS effectiveness, improve user experience, and facilitate data-driven decision-making, the HR Systems Analyst will work in conjunction with HR management and other stakeholders.
